CS3451 Introduction to Operation Systems Notes - Anna University Regulation 2021
Download CS3451 Introduction to Operation Systems Notes for Anna University Regulation 2021 students. This page provides high-quality Anna University study materials, lecture notes, and handwritten notes for branches CSE and IT Semester 4. Students can easily access Introduction to Operation Systems notes PDF download, important questions, and previous year Anna University question papers to prepare effectively for internal assessments and university exams.
Notes PDFs
Study Materials
-
CS3451-Introduction to Operation Systems-handwritten.pdf
-
CS3451-Introduction to Operation Systems_compressed.pdf
About CS3451 Introduction to Operation Systems
CS3451 is a core subject for Anna University Semester 4 students, introducing the fundamentals of operating systems, process management, memory, and virtualization. These CS3451 notes are designed to help you understand key concepts in a simple, step-by-step manner. Whether you are preparing for internal assessments or university exams, our Anna University study materials and CS3451 important topics make revision faster and more effective. With clear explanations and practical examples, you can build a strong foundation in Introduction to Operation Systems and improve your exam scores.
Using these CS3451 notes Anna University resources, you can quickly revise all units, clarify doubts, and practice with repeated exam questions. The content is tailored for easy learning and better retention, making your exam preparation stress-free and productive.
What You Get on This Page
- Easy-to-understand lecture notes for all units
- Handpicked important topics frequently asked in exams
- Quick links to previous year question papers and additional resources
These resources are perfect for last-minute revision, semester exam preparation, and internal tests. All materials are organized for CSE and IT branches following Regulation 2021.
CS3451 - Introduction to Operating Systems Important Topics (Unit-wise)
Operating systems is a core subject that helps students understand how software and hardware work together. A clear unit-wise preparation plan helps you answer both theory and problem-based questions in exams with better accuracy and confidence.
Unit I - Introduction to Operating Systems
This unit builds the base for the full subject. Focus on definitions, service models, and architecture diagrams because these are frequently asked in short and long answers.
- System calls: types of system calls with suitable examples
- Operating system architecture models and layered design
- Android architecture and key components
- System programs and their role in OS usage
- Evolution of operating systems from batch to modern systems
- Explain five major services provided by an operating system
Unit II - Process Management and Synchronization
This unit is important for both concept-based and numerical/problem-based questions. Practice deadlock and scheduling problems step by step for full marks.
- Deadlock conditions and resource allocation graph basics
- Deadlock prevention, avoidance, detection, and recovery
- Deadlock avoidance problems
- CPU scheduling algorithms: FCFS, SJF, Priority, and Round Robin
- CPU scheduling problems: waiting time and turnaround time calculation
- Dining Philosophers problem, critical section, and monitor solution
- Semaphores: definition, operations, and mutual exclusion implementation
Unit III - Memory Management
Memory management is a high-weight unit in many exams. Combine diagram practice with numerical problems to score well in paging and replacement questions.
- Paging concept with address translation diagram
- Page table structure and logical-to-physical mapping
- Paging problems with frame and page number calculations
- Page replacement algorithms: FIFO, LRU, and Optimal (theory + problems)
- Segmentation and comparison with paging
- Thrashing causes, effects, and control methods
- Frame allocation strategies in memory management
Unit IV - File Systems and I/O Management
This unit connects storage concepts with I/O performance. Learn directory formats and scheduling steps clearly to handle both descriptive and problem-oriented questions.
- Directory structures and file organization concepts
- File allocation methods: contiguous, linked, and indexed
- File allocation problems and comparison-based questions
- Disk scheduling algorithms: FCFS, SSTF, SCAN, and C-SCAN
- Disk scheduling problems with total head movement calculation
- Kernel I/O subsystem components and buffering concepts
- File mounting, file sharing, and protection mechanisms
Unit V - Virtualization and Mobile Operating Systems
This unit covers modern operating system trends. Focus on virtualization methods and mobile OS architecture because these topics are commonly asked as concept-based long answers.
- Virtual machines: system VM and process VM types
- Virtual machine implementation basics and hypervisor role
- Virtualization techniques and practical benefits
- Mobile OS architecture and features in iOS
- Mobile OS architecture and features in Android
- Common features and challenges of mobile operating systems
Frequently Asked Questions (FAQ)
What is CS3451 subject about?
CS3451 covers operating system concepts, process management, memory, and virtualization. It helps students understand how software and hardware interact to manage resources efficiently.
Are these CS3451 notes enough for exam preparation?
Yes, these notes are prepared to cover the full Anna University syllabus and include important topics. For best results, use them along with your classroom materials and practice solving previous year questions.
How should I use these CS3451 notes effectively?
Start by reading each unit summary, then practice the important topics provided. Revise regularly and use the syllabus overview to track your progress before exams.
Where can I find the official Anna University syllabus?
You can access the official Anna University syllabus for CS3451 through the "View Syllabus" button in the Additional Resources section above.
Are the important topics here repeated in Anna University exams?
Many topics listed are based on previous exam trends and are likely to be repeated. Practicing these will help you score higher in both internals and semester exams.
Additional Resources
Other Subjects in Semester 4
LearnSkart offers well-organized Anna University notes, study materials, and exam preparation resources for all departments including CSE, ECE, EEE, Mechanical, Civil, and IT. These materials help students understand key concepts quickly and score better in exams. Download the latest CS3451 Anna University notes PDF and start your exam preparation today.